PART A Section 1: Scenario
Your friend, Lisa Daniels, is considering starting a web design business. The name of this company will be SlickWeb. To get started quickly they were considering just using clip art, images, sounds and movie clips found online. After all, it is online so anyone can use it yes? Your friend said they didn’t see any copyright warnings. You warned them that just because it is online, does not mean it is free.
Your friend has heard terms such as trademarked, copyright, intellectual property (IP), creative commons license but does not really know much about them.
Lisa would very much like to know how she can attribute copyright to her work and work her company creates that she wants to make freely available. She does not wish all work to be free just materials uploaded to the “free resources” section she is planning to have on the company website. With these free resources, Lisa wants both author of the work and the company name to be attributed. She feels the free resources could help demonstrate the company design skills. She is happy for the public to use the resources provided that Slickweb receives credit for it, they are not modified, and that people do not make money from those resources.
SlickWeb offers a variety of services including
• Web consulting
• Web design
• Web hosting
• Content management
• Asset creation – animation / video / images + photography
PART A Section 1: Your task
Research current Australian IP (intellectual property), copyright legislation and standards that would be relevant to this scenario. Remember websites are media rich so it would not only be pictures. Text content, design, sounds, video and interactive content such as SCORM objects are all subject to legislation.
Write a document to Lisa that covers the following
1. Current legislation and standards relating to intellectual property and copyright in Australia. You should include and explain 3 items of Australian legislation, one of the three must be the 1968 copyright act.
2. Explanation on how the creative commons license works. Which kind should Lisa use for the materials they are giving away for free that lets people know that attribution is required and that they would not be authorised to make money from the free materials?
3. An explanation on what their future web design business has to know regarding using clip art, images, sounds and movie clips found online. Give examples and a thorough explanation.
4. Two samples of a copyright policy from another Australian web design firm that you can show Lisa as examples. Provide a full copy of the policy (ie cut and paste it into your assignment document), the direct URL and explain the KEY sections you find in each policy. (Suggest to find small policies)
